Optimum day by day exposure (MDE) is the full volume of the excipient that would be taken or Utilized in a day based upon the maximum day by day dose (MDD) from the drug products and solutions during which it is actually employed. MDE is calculated given that the dosage device amount of the excipient multiplied by the most range of dosage models suggested every day (excipient (mg) x range models).
